    What happened

    BlackRock Inc. posted a 46% gain in quarterly profit for Q1 2026.

    The Context

    • Record inflows: BlackRock's iShares ETF business led to a remarkable $130 billion in total net inflows, showcasing strong demand from both retail and institutional investors.
    • Resilience amid volatility: Despite market fluctuations, BlackRock's assets under management reached $13.89 trillion, reflecting its robust position in the asset management sector.
    • Strategic expansion: The firm continues to enhance its capabilities through acquisitions and has established a presence in the UAE, tapping into regional growth opportunities.

    The Number

    46%

    — This year-over-year increase in net income to $2.2 billion highlights BlackRock's ability to capitalize on market trends, which could influence your investment decisions.
